You can indicate word stress by placing an asterisk * or a bullet point • after a stressed vowel (e.g., теҥге•, теҥге* 'ruble'). Otherwise, stress is assumed to follow regular patterns. Indicate orthographically unmarked palatalization with an accent, e.g.: имн'e 'horse'. Alternatively, if you do not specify the word stress and palatalization, the software will consult our lexicon. In the case of homographs (i.e., two words spelled the same, but not necessarily pronounced - and inflected - the same, e.g., ше•рге 'expensive' <> шерге• 'comb', the software will pick the word listed in the dictionary first.

For the sake of simplicity, only the plural suffix -влак and the possessive suffix first person singular -ем are displayed here. Also note that other suffix arrangements than these can be encountered on occasion - these are only the most common ones.
Case | Cx + Px | Cx + Nx | Cx + Px + Nx |
---|---|---|---|
Nominative: | jədaŋem | jədaŋ-βlak | jədaŋ-βlakem, jədaŋem-βlak |
Genitive: | jədaŋemən | jədaŋ-βlakən | jədaŋ-βlakemən, jədaŋem-βlakən |
Dative: | jədaŋemlan, jədaŋlanem | jədaŋ-βlaklan | jədaŋ-βlakemlan, jədaŋem-βlaklan |
Accusative: | jədaŋeməm | jədaŋ-βlakəm | jədaŋ-βlakeməm, jədaŋem-βlakəm |
Comparative: | jədaŋemla, jədaŋlam | jədaŋ-βlakla | jədaŋ-βlakemla, jədaŋem-βlakla |
Comitative: | jədaŋemge | jədaŋ-βlakge | jədaŋ-βlakemge, jədaŋem-βlakge |
Inessive: | jədaŋəʃtem | jədaŋ-βlakəʃte | jədaŋ-βlakəʃtem, jədaŋem-βlakəʃte |
Illative: | jədaŋəʃkem | jədaŋ-βlakəʃ(ke) | jədaŋ-βlakəʃkem, jədaŋem-βlakəʃ(ke) |
Lative: | jədaŋeʃem | jədaŋ-βlakeʃ | jədaŋ-βlakeʃem, jədaŋem-βlakeʃ |
